摘要
In this study, it was examined Ataturk boulevard's Street trees in Cankiri province. It was evaluated some properties (space identification, aesthetic suitability, functional suitability and healty status) of trees. Geographic Information Systems were used for space identification of Ataturk Boulevard's trees. Functional suitability, a esthetics suitability and healthy of plants were evaluated as a result of field observations and studies. Plant material was evaluated by the four sections as an intersection points cutting of the Ataturk boulevard. It was used in 24 different species of plants on Ataturk boulevard. Plants were planted randomly. Some principles of planting design(series, rhythm, repetition) were not used. As a result of these were prevented to appearance aesthetically successful planting. Planting throughout Ataturk Boulevard appears nonfunctional and bad. Planting scheme of evergreen tree and evergreen shrubs also seems in appropriate. Again, the crown widths of all plant species are not cons idered ideal planting. Plants were planted more often than the distance between the ideal crown widths. Determination of plant material with GIS provinces of Ataturk Boulevard, the management of plant material provides important information to local authorities. Transferring of information plan and maps as coordinate with GIS maps allow the assessment of the suitability of plant material and functional suitability of the place. Also, ensuring continuity and care of plant material was helped.
